Meaning of valiance

The primary meaning of the word "valiance" refers to bravery or courage, especially in battle or when facing danger.

Etymology of valiance

The word "valiance" originates from the Old French word "valiance," which is derived from the Latin word "valentia," meaning "strength" or "bravery"
Historically, the term was used to describe the bravery or martial prowess of a knight or warrior, and has since evolved to encompass a broader range of contexts and applications

Definitions

  • The quality of being brave or courageous, especially in the face of danger or adversity
  • * A show of bravery or courage, especially in a challenging or threatening situation

Usage Examples

  • The firefighter showed remarkable valiance in rescuing people from the burning building
  • * The soldier's valiance in the face of enemy fire earned her a medal for bravery
